What's The Definition Of Juke?
juke in American English
to outmaneuver by a feint or other deceptive movement to outmaneuver someone in such a manner juke in American English 1 noun: a fake or feint, usually intended to deceive a defensive player transitive verb: to make a move intended to deceive (an opponent) juke in American English 2 noun: a jukebox juke in British English noun: a small roadside establishment that plays music and provides refreshments |
